Dragons sign Thomas Rhys Thomas from London Wasps

The Dragons will welcome Rhys Thomas to Rodney Parade next season; the 30 year old international hooker will head home to Wales after a season with the Wasps.

Thomas made his debut for Wales against USA eagles on 4 June 2005 and has achieved 27 caps.

 

Born in Abercynon, Thomas started playing rugby at Abercynon RFC, aged 8 and began his professional career at Cardiff RFC in 2003. Thomas made a try-scoring debut for the Cardiff Blues against Celtic Warriors on 27 December 2003.

 

Speaking of the signing Rob Beale, Director of Rugby said, “We are delighted to have such an experienced player join our squad next season. I’m sure Rhys will have a big impact on and off the field during his time here at the Dragons.”

 

Head Coach Darren Edwards Comments, “Rhys will be a great addition to our pack of forwards, he brings with him a wealth of experience. I am confident he will make a difference on the field and also be a great mentor for our other hookers and young players.”
